hpfs: convert hpfs to use the new mount api
authorEric Sandeen <sandeen@redhat.com>
Wed, 25 Sep 2024 13:17:06 +0000 (15:17 +0200)
committerChristian Brauner <brauner@kernel.org>
Tue, 8 Oct 2024 12:41:53 +0000 (14:41 +0200)
Convert the hpfs filesystem to use the new mount API.
Tested by comparing random mount & remount options before and after
the change.
